精华区 [关闭][返回]

当前位置:网易精华区>>讨论区精华>>社区互动>>焦点新闻事件>>第八期热点话题"应届就业">>为什么大家都要走IT这座独木桥?

主题:为什么大家都要走IT这座独木桥?
发信人: skyblue263(天蓝)
整理人: aaa234(2003-01-08 20:16:00), 站内信件
    每年我都要面试单位人事部通过初选后的将毕业学生,当然主要求职当程序员的,每年都特别多应聘的,而且个个都象立下死志这辈子非程序员不干了,那么好吧,我先看一下哪些?

    专业是不限制的,计算机、机械、电子、光学、物理、数据、经管。。。都行,我只想看一下你学的几门课的成绩,选修课程不计,做程序员需要极大的责任心,因为你做的工作往往只有你自己知道,外人极少插手,你必须负责到底,不管多累多闷多烦,只要系统有人用,就可能需要你维护到底,如果你连自己的学业都坚持不下来,我会怀疑你能做好什么工作,何况还是一个程序员呢。

    想当程序员的麻烦把高等数学、离散数学、概率、汇编、计算机原理、微机原理、数据结构、光学、通信工程等类课程的成绩学得好看点,这些课目的确有用的不多,但是你在学校学的是一种思维结构以及动手能力,越是抽象类的课程越能看出你的思维素质,越是需要动手的课程越是能看出你的手底下是不是有两把刷子,需要你做大系统越需要你对微观有基本认识。

    然后,你的社会工作。班长、支书、学习委员、生活委员、宣传委员、学生会主席、部长、干事。。。什么都行,做大系统的时候,每个程序员都是一颗螺丝钉,所以我不需要特别长和特别短的钉,我只需要能够配合别人的钉。而且你不会永远当程序员,没两年可能就要你独当一面了,组织能力和协作能力,甚至于写作能力都是不可缺少的基本素质,书面的东西永远比嘴皮子有说服力。

    再次,你做过什么东西?这东西不是上课的习题或上机题,而是真正做过什么软件?比如给些公司做个财务软件,给老师做个分析软件。。。不要告诉你做过网页,FLASH,OFFICE。。。这些是文员干的活,别告诉我你做个什么局域网,这些是简单的硬件维护工作。编过一个1500行以上的软件,是我理想的要求,调试这么长的程序是每个程序员必须的痛苦经历。当然,这对你要求可能也太高了点,那么至少你会C语言吧,会SQL SERVER以及ODBS使用吧,懂MS的太多了,我需要至少知道那么一点UNIX。

    做程序员有两种人比较适合,聪明学什么都快、坚韧能够坐那里不知道白天黑夜(当然不是玩游戏)。我更倾向于选择后者,一个大系统的生命期在5年以上,小软件也可能要用个3、4年,耐得住性子熬是成长的过程。聪明的往往坐不住而且配合能力不佳,只适合小打小闹。别以为,做IT每天都学习新东西,哪有的事,我们一个系统的投资都是五年以上的长远投资,较多的工作都是重复的,或者只是修修补补,每天都在学新东西的说明你什么东西都做得不好。

    别考太多证书了,没有实践为后盾的证书不说明任何问题,而且浪费了父母的血汗钱。

    对了,最后告诉你,我们不可能给没有经验的菜鸟程序员付5000元月薪的,资深的也没有。实习期后,你可能每月有2000…2500元吧,以后看你自己发展,如果你永远是程序员的话,不会涨大多了。

    海阔凭鱼跃,天高任鸟飞。现在市场上IT行业的薪酬是较一般高,但其实只是公司的利润高或销售的收入高(可能连这也谈不上),程序员只是一种高级蓝领,残酷的竞争逼使公司不得不把利润的大部分分给营销人员,从付出和收入效益比来说,没有比当程序员底。而且沉默寡言、离群索居、少小白头的程序员真的不适合大部分有热血的年轻人做,电脑永远是工具,不可能是人类社会发展的目标。

    几年来原来招的程序员中,往往刚开始只有不到一半适合做程序员的,更少的人现在还在做(当然要高级一点),他们很多已经干别的去了(维护、管理等等),大部分人都做得很好,相信如果你早点认识自己合适干什么可能会走得更好,刚毕业的年轻人人生的路应该很宽,何必现在就决定呢。

[关闭][返回]